域名解析配置错误
配置CDN时最常见的错误是DNS解析设置不正确。主要表现为:
- 未将域名正确指向CDN服务商提供的CNAME地址
- 子域名未同步更新解析记录
- 未验证DNS记录生效状态
解决方法应使用dig命令验证解析状态,并确保所有相关域名在DNS控制台完成CNAME配置。
源站设置不当
源站配置问题会导致CDN节点无法正常拉取资源,具体表现为:
- 防火墙未开放CDN服务商的IP段
- 未配置合理的缓存控制头
- 源站响应超时设置过短
建议在源站配置中启用健康检查机制,并设置合理的带宽限制参数。
HTTPS/SSL配置问题
安全协议配置错误可能引发混合内容警告或连接中断:
- 证书链配置不完整
- 未开启回源SNI支持
- HTTP/HTTPS协议混用
需在CDN控制台完整上传证书文件,并开启强制HTTPS跳转功能。
缓存策略配置错误
不合理的缓存设置会导致资源更新延迟或缓存污染:
- 动态内容错误配置缓存
- 静态资源缓存时间过短
- 未设置版本号哈希机制
建议针对不同资源类型设置分层缓存策略,静态资源建议缓存30天以上。
正确配置CDN节点需要遵循服务商的最佳实践指南,重点关注域名解析、源站互通、安全协议和缓存策略四个核心环节。建议配置完成后使用自动化监控工具进行全链路检测,并定期进行配置审计。